Building Success: A Guide to Real Estate Mobile App Development

In today’s fast-paced world, mobile apps have become indispensable across industries, and the real estate sector is no exception. With more people turning to their smartphones for property search, buying, and renting, the demand for innovative, user-friendly, and feature-packed real estate mobile app development is at an all-time high. Building a successful real estate mobile app requires more than just technical expertise—it involves understanding user needs, incorporating cutting-edge technologies, and creating a seamless experience from start to finish.

This guide provides you with everything you need to know about real estate mobile app development, including best practices, essential features, and how to build a strong foundation for success.

The Importance of Real Estate Mobile Apps

The real estate industry is known for its complexity, with processes ranging from property searches to negotiations and legal documentation. Gone are the days when people relied solely on real estate agents or desktop websites to find properties. Today, consumers expect quick access to listings, high-quality visuals, and personalized experiences, all from the convenience of their mobile devices.

Developing a real estate mobile app enables businesses to stay competitive by offering their customers a direct and efficient channel for property browsing, purchases, and other services. For agents and property managers, it means increased exposure, better client interaction, and the ability to streamline their operations.

Key Steps in Real Estate Mobile App Development

Creating a real estate mobile app requires careful planning, a clear strategy, and the right tools. Here are the essential steps involved:

  1. Market Research and Analysis

    • Before you begin development, it’s crucial to analyze your target audience. What kind of features do they need? Are they looking for easy property searches, virtual tours, or a quick booking system? By understanding your customers' pain points, you can create an app that adds real value.
    • Analyze your competitors as well. What are the leading apps in the market offering? What sets them apart? Studying their success and challenges will help you design an app that stands out.
  2. Defining Features and Functionality

    • Once you have a clear understanding of your market, it's time to define the features your app will include. Essential features for a real estate mobile app typically include:
      • Property Search Filters (Location, Price, Type, etc.)
      • Virtual Tours and Interactive Maps
      • Push Notifications for New Listings
      • In-app Chat for Agent Communication
      • Reviews and Ratings for Properties and Agents
      • Integration with Payment Systems for Seamless Transactions
      • Social Media Sharing Options
      • Real-Time Property Updates and Alerts
  3. Choosing the Right Development Approach

    • When it comes to developing your app, you need to decide whether you want to build a native app, hybrid app, or progressive web app (PWA). Native apps are platform-specific (iOS or Android), while hybrid apps work across multiple platforms.
    • Depending on your target audience, your budget, and the scope of the app, you’ll need to choose the approach that best aligns with your goals.
  4. UI/UX Design

    • The user experience (UX) is crucial for retaining users. An app that is difficult to navigate or too slow can lead to high abandonment rates. Prioritize a clean, intuitive, and easy-to-use interface (UI). Your app should be visually appealing, but also functional.
    • Incorporating elements like high-quality images, interactive maps, and smooth scrolling can enhance the user experience.
  5. Integration with Third-Party Services

    • For a more comprehensive experience, integrate your app with third-party services like property management tools, CRM software, and payment gateways.
    • For instance, integrating real-time MLS (Multiple Listing Service) data into your app will ensure that listings are always up-to-date.
  6. Testing and Quality Assurance

    • It’s important to thoroughly test your app on multiple devices and operating systems. This ensures that the app works flawlessly across various screen sizes and platforms. Testing should include performance, security, usability, and functionality testing to ensure a bug-free, high-quality final product.
  7. Launch and Marketing

    • Once the app is ready, the next step is Launch your On Demand Real Estate Website and mobile app. Your marketing strategy should focus on digital channels like social media, email marketing, and SEO to promote your app. Building a strong online presence will help attract users and agents to your platform.

On-Demand Real Estate App Development

The concept of on-demand real estate app development is gaining popularity in today’s digital world. On-demand apps allow users to access real estate services whenever they need them, whether it’s for viewing properties, booking showings, or speaking directly with agents.

For example, users can instantly schedule property viewings or request services like home appraisals or repair work. The real-time nature of on-demand services increases convenience for users and gives real estate businesses a competitive edge by offering flexibility and immediate access.

Why Choose a Real Estate App Builder?

Building a real estate mobile app from scratch can be complex and time-consuming, especially if you lack technical expertise. That’s where a real estate app builder comes into play. These platforms allow you to create your own mobile app without coding knowledge. They offer pre-designed templates and customization options that you can tailor to your business needs.

Many app builders are equipped with drag-and-drop features, integrations with real estate APIs, and analytics tools that help you monitor your app’s performance. Some platforms also offer customer support to ensure that your app is functional and up-to-date.

Monetization Strategies for Real Estate Apps

Once your real estate mobile app is live, it's time to think about how to monetize it. Some common monetization strategies include:

  • Subscription Model: Charge users or agents a monthly/annual fee for premium features.
  • In-app Purchases: Offer additional services like property analytics or virtual staging.
  • Commission-Based: Take a percentage from successful property transactions conducted through the app.
  • Ad Revenue: Display ads to users within the app and earn revenue.

Conclusion

The potential of real estate mobile app development is vast, with numerous opportunities for both businesses and users. By focusing on user-friendly design, essential features, and seamless functionality, you can create an app that attracts a loyal user base. Whether you’re a real estate agent, developer, or property management company, building an app is an investment that can significantly improve your service offerings, enhance user experiences, and ultimately drive revenue.

If you're ready to take the leap, consider working with expert developers who can guide you through the on-demand real estate app development process and help you launch your on-demand real estate website. The future of real estate is mobile, and now is the time to build your success.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ow